Browse Source

no message

FengChaoYu 7 months ago
parent
commit
eee7bbf0a9

+ 4 - 1
mall-server-api/src/main/java/com/gree/mall/manager/bean/worker/WebsitWorkerBean.java

@@ -8,9 +8,12 @@ import lombok.Data;
 @Data
 public class WebsitWorkerBean {
 
-    @ApiModelProperty(value = "师傅编号")
+    @ApiModelProperty(value = "师傅id")
     private String workerId;
 
+    @ApiModelProperty(value = "师傅编号")
+    private String workerNumber;
+
     @ApiModelProperty(value = "师傅名称")
     private String workerName;
 }

+ 4 - 2
mall-server-api/src/main/java/com/gree/mall/manager/logic/worker/WorkerTeamLogic.java

@@ -168,13 +168,15 @@ public class WorkerTeamLogic {
                 .in(User::getUserId, websitUsers.stream().map(WebsitUser::getUserId).collect(Collectors.toList()))
                 .list();
 
-        final Map<String, String> userMap = userList.stream().collect(Collectors.toMap(User::getUserId, User::getNickName));
+        final Map<String, User> userMap = userList.stream().collect(Collectors.toMap(User::getUserId, Function.identity()));
         List<WebsitWorkerBean> beanList = new ArrayList<>();
         for (WebsitUser websitUser : websitUsers) {
             if (userMap.containsKey(websitUser.getUserId())) {
+                final User user = userMap.get(websitUser.getUserId());
                 WebsitWorkerBean bean = new WebsitWorkerBean();
                 bean.setWorkerId(websitUser.getUserId());
-                bean.setWorkerName(userMap.get(websitUser.getUserId()));
+                bean.setWorkerId(user.getWorkerNumber());
+                bean.setWorkerName(user.getNickName());
                 beanList.add(bean);
             }
         }